Sas create new variable in dataset
WebbProgramming statements are used to manipulate the variables in the data set, create new variables, label and format variables, and exclude observations from the data set. Line 4: Tells SAS that the data to be analyzed are next. Note that … Webb27 jan. 2024 · The basic code to create two datasets is as follows: DATA New-Dataset-Name-1 (OPTIONS) New-Dataset-Name-2 (OPTIONS); SET Old-Dataset-Name (OPTIONS); IF (insert conditions for Dataset1) THEN OUTPUT New-Dataset-Name-1; IF (insert conditions for Dataset2) THEN OUTPUT New-Dataset-Name-2; RUN;
Sas create new variable in dataset
Did you know?
Webb8 maj 2024 · SAS procedure to create new columns based on variable values. Ask Question. Asked 2 years, 11 months ago. Modified 2 years, 11 months ago. Viewed 96 … Webb28 maj 2024 · Here's one method: Assuming all of the variables names are stored in a variable (column) called Data2Var in work.data2, then this should work: proc sql noprint; …
WebbThis video helps you understand How to Create a New Variable in SAS and this is explained through the eyes of Microsoft Excel therefore it becomes more easie...
Webb23 dec. 2024 · To modify how SAS displays a variable, you use the FORMAT=-option followed by the desired format. Syntax of the FORMAT =-option in the SELECT statement: SELECT variable-name FORMAT= format-name, variable-name FORMAT =format-name, variable-name FORMAT= format-name, etc.; Example: SELECT income FORMAT= … WebbFor example, there are six variables in data set ONE in the positional order of A, B, C, D, E, and F. If the new order needs to be A, E, C, D, B, and F, then the following DATA step reorders the variables in that order: data two; retain a e c d b; set one; run;
Webb23 juli 2024 · Creating a numeric variable You can create variables using the form: variable = expression; Suppose you are asked to create a new variable NewRate, in the existing SAS data set Example1. Both variables are numeric. The variable NewRate is twice of OldRate. DATA Example1; SET Example1; NewRate=3*OldRate; RUN; Output:
Webb10 jan. 2024 · Method 1: Add Row Number data my_data2; row_number = _N_; set my_data1; run; Method 2: Add Row Number by Group /*sort original dataset by var1*/ proc sort data=my_data1; by var1; run; /*create new dataset that shows row number by var1*/ data my_data2; set my_data1; by var1; if first.var1 then row_number=0; row_number+1; run; how to buy smrtWebbcreate new variables in SAS using do loop. Ask Question. Asked 7 years, 6 months ago. Modified 7 years, 6 months ago. Viewed 974 times. 1. I have a SAS program that has a … how to buy smithing stones 7Webb8 mars 2024 · You can use the FIRST. and LAST. functions in SAS to identify the first and last observations by group in a SAS dataset.. Here is what each function does in a … meyerding 1 therapieWebbIn a DATA step, you can create a new variable and assign it a value by using it for the first time on the left side of an assignment statement. SAS determines the length of a variable from its first occurrence in the DATA step. The new variable gets the same type and … refers to the instructions that SAS uses when reading data values. If no informat i… If the conversion is not possible, SAS prints a note to the log, assigns the numeric … how to buy sms bundles on mtn ugandaWebb9 jan. 2024 · The results should show the title which is the dataset name, the first column should be the variable name, and the second column should be the variable type … meyerding surgical instrumentWebb25 feb. 2024 · 5 Ways to Create New Variables in SAS [Easy & Quick Methods] 1. Create a New Variable in SAS: Using the Length Statement in DATA Step This is the simplest way … meyerding spondylolisthesisWebb12 okt. 2015 · Create data set from macro variable SAS. I have a macro variable which stores a string of names, for example: I wanted to transpose each element (to appear as … how to buy smithing stones 3 and 4